About the job:
The Red Hat Tech Sales team is seeking a Senior Specialist Solution Architect to join us in Minnesota, preferably in the Minneapolis area. In this role, you will support the Ansible Tech Sales team and provide pre-sales technical support to prospects. You'll work with key customers both on site and remotely to build a relationship of trust and confidence between Red Hat and the customer's engineering, development, and operations teams. To be successful, you'll need to gain an understanding of the customer's business needs and align those needs with the capabilities of our solutions. You will also play a crucial role in bringing together internal cross-functional teams to satisfy our most challenging customers. You'll serve as the customer's advocate with these teams to architect the best solution and ensure that it is implemented and supported in an innovative and reliable way.
What you will do:
+ Discover and analyze customers' business and technical problems, and design the appropriate Red Hat solution that aligns to their needs
+ Provide technical leadership to Red Hat account teams and customers through sales presentations, product demonstrations, workshops and proofs of concept
+ Utilize your technical expertise to assist sales teams in answering customer questions
+ Form strategic business and technical relationships within each customer organization to identify new opportunities
+ Own and attain a bookings quota by utilizing your expertise to contribute to the success of our Account Teams in closing sales opportunities
+ Share your expertise by contributing to documentation (e.g., wikis, quick-start guides, blog posts, and whitepapers), developing reusable assets (e.g., demonstrations, workshops), and presenting at conferences and industry events
+ Collaborate broadly with Red Hat Engineering and Business Units, Professional Services, Sales teams, and partners to ensure excellent customer experience with our offerings and solutions
What you will bring:
+ Experience in sales engineering, consulting, IT architecture, or equivalent in supporting large organizations
+ Excellent communication, presentation, documentation, and problem solving skills
+ Positive team player attitude and strong desire to make our customers successful
+ Ability to understand customers' challenges, requirements, and technical issues and collaborate to address those with the appropriate technologies and solutions
+ Experience with and intimate knowledge of DevOps/Automation tools such as Ansible, CI Tools, Git, Python (or other similar/relevant experience)
+ Significant technical experience in **at least one** major IT domain, such as:
+ Infrastructure-as-a-Service (IaaS) or Platform-as-a-Service (PaaS) solutions
+ Linux-based workloads
+ Continuous integration (CI) and continuous deployment (CD) pipeline
+ Network technologies like Cisco, Juniper, Checkpoint
+ Kubernetes and container-based deployments
+ Public cloud providers such as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, Google Cloud, or IBM Cloud
+ Windows-based environment management
+ InfoSec / Security Operations
+ Willingness to travel within the region
One or more of the following is a plus
+ Experience in scripting and/or coding (especially Python)
+ Education from a presales training program
+ Any Red Hat certification
+ Background in public speaking, such as experience giving presentations or demonstrations (this also includes performance arts)
The salary range for this position is $168,650.00 - $269,960.00 (inclusive of base pay + target incentive compensation). Actual offer will be based on your qualifications.
Pay Transparency
Red Hat determines compensation based on several factors including but not limited to job location, experience, applicable skills and training, external market value, and internal pay equity. Annual salary is one component of Red Hat’s compensation package. This position may also be eligible for bonus, commission, and/or equity. For positions with Remote-US locations, the actual salary range for the position may differ based on location but will be commensurate with job duties and relevant work experience.
